How Can I Get an Invitation to Google Plus?

Google introduced their highly anticipated social network, Google Plus, on Tuesday as an invite-only service. Not surprisingly, a lot of people are interested in trying it out.

The folks at Google allowed current members to invite friends for a short window last week, and we started a Google Plus Invite thread at Lifehacker to spread the love. Unfortunately, Google closed invites shortly thereafter.

So how do you get an invitation now?

For starters, you should visit the start page and sign up for an invite whenever Google gets around to sending one. But that's the obvious route, and it could take a while.

If you happen to know someone who's already got a Google Plus invite, you do have another option, which I tested and which worked for me. Keep in mind that Google could always change this, so you mileage may vary.
